    OK for those having the YouTube 480p bug (ie, can't select 720 or 1080p-60fps playback from any video) I have a fix!

    Tested and working on my OP3

    First close the youtube app and go into settings, Apps and scroll down and hit YouTube.
    Now tap Disable App BUT say NO to downgrading to earliest version, next tap Clear Cache followed by Clear Data.
    Reboot Phone but just to be sure I would do it again once it booted back up without opening the youtube app.

    Once done twice you will (should) see 1080p vids once more.

  • Registered Users, Registered Users 2 Posts: 1,145 ✭✭✭gar


    pedatron wrote: »
    Excuse my stupidity but do you have to download the signed flashable zip and then the OTA zip? Like the both of them? or is it just the OTA? Can't follow the wording of it on XDA

    I did it earlier.
    Flash the 3.2.1 signed flashable zip, wipe cache and dalvik, flash supersu, wipe cache and dalvik again and reboot.

    Second wipe probably not necessary

    Oh and do a backup 1st.

    Not liable for your phone going boom ;-)
